Global soccer sensation Cristiano Ronaldo has unveiled a new line of recovery and fitness products under his new brand AVA, Advanced Recovery For Athletes.

The venture is a partnership between CR7 and Brazilian outfit Avanutri. AVA’s website says its lineup is based on “Experience, in-depth knowledge of needs, and a tireless desire to innovate,” and offers “cutting-edge technology in physical recovery.”
